Great piece "Demonizing foreign students sidesteps solutions to Canada’s problems" by @yvonnesu.bsky.social theconversation.com/demonizing-f...
Demonizing foreign students sidesteps solutions to Canada’s problems
The Canadian government has said international students are abusing Canada’s asylum system. However, the data does not back the government’s claims.

The moral panic around asylum seekers, particularly international students, ignores reality: Asylum is not automatic, and many claims are rejected.

My latest with @policyoptions.bsky.social

policyoptions.irpp.org/magazines/ja...
The truth about asylum in Canada
The moral panic around asylum seekers, particularly international students, ignores reality: Asylum is not automatic, and many claims are rejected.
